WHAT IS A DATA BREACH?
A data breach occurs when a company or entity has information leaked or stolen. Companies have a responsibility and a duty of care for the information within their systems. When data under their control is accessed by unauthorized individuals or otherwise compromised, we call this a data breach. This data usually includes personal information about employees, clients, customers, etc.
Information regularly compromised is referred to as Personally Identifiable Information (“PII”) (including such things as names, addresses, social security numbers, driver’s license numbers, and telephone numbers) or Protected Health Information (“PHI”) (including information related to your medical records, treatment, and insurance. Businesses are required to secure this information or risk facing statutory and other penalties. Stolen PII and PHI can be used by identity thieves to engage in fraudulent activity using your identity.

WHAT IS A CLASS REP ?
A class rep is someone with a particularly strong case and is willing to provide evidence of their case to a court if necessary, representing the entire class of people who were harmed by the breach. In most cases, an actual court appearance isn’t needed, but having a client who is ready and willing to be called on makes our case significantly stronger. Because of the extra time and effort of a class rep, they will receive a service award, which consists of extra monetary compensation.
